[QUOTE="Troutsqueezer, post: 8110651, member: 655099"] Greetings, first post. I have a variety of unstuffed PCB's from SoundStream's line of amplifiers. The reason is, I was the one who designed them back when, as one of the engineers who worked for SS and Stewart Electronics. The question: Would it be worth the effort to try and sell them on eBay? I know a lot of people like the older amps and SoundStream but don't know if they would have any interest in the blank (but silkscreened) pcb's. Thanks. [/QUOTE]
